Behind Every EV Charger

Panel Upgrades, Dedicated Circuits & Service Capacity

The charger is the easy part. The electrical work behind it is what makes the install safe and code-compliant.

Panel Evaluation

Before every install, we evaluate your existing electrical panel — checking available capacity, breaker space, and total connected load — to confirm it can safely support the EV charger.

Panel Upgrades for EV Chargers

If your panel is full or undersized (common in older Indianapolis and Marion County homes), we install a properly sized panel upgrade — typically 200A or larger — to safely support the EV charger plus future loads.

Dedicated 240V Circuits

EV chargers require their own dedicated 240-volt circuit, sized to the charger's amperage. We run new circuits from the panel to the charger location with the correct breaker, conductors, and conduit.

Subpanels & Load Management

For garages, detached structures, and multi-charger setups, we install subpanels and load-management hardware so multiple chargers can share capacity safely without overloading the service.

Service Upgrades for Commercial Sites

Commercial EV charging — especially fleet and multi-charger sites — often requires a service entrance upgrade. We coordinate with the utility and handle the full service-upgrade scope.

EV-Ready Wiring for New Builds

Building or remodeling? We rough in EV-ready wiring during construction so the charger install is plug-and-play later. The cheapest time to wire for an EV charger is before the drywall goes up.

Where Will Your Charger Go?

Indoor, Garage & Outdoor EV Charger Placement

The right location depends on your property, your vehicle, your panel location, and how you actually park.

Attached Garage

The most common — and usually simplest — install location. Short conduit run, indoor environment, and a clean wall mount near where you park.

Detached Garage

Detached garages typically need a subpanel or a longer feeder run from the main service. We trench, run conduit, and install properly sized wiring for the distance.

Driveway & Outdoor

Outdoor wall, post, or pedestal-mounted EV chargers are fully viable in Indiana when installed with the right NEMA-rated enclosure, conduit, and weather-sealed terminations.

Carport & Covered Parking

Carports and covered parking get the simplicity of an outdoor install with weather protection. We mount the charger overhead or wall-side depending on layout.

Commercial Parking Lots

Commercial parking lot EV charging stations require conduit runs, trenching, bollard protection, signage coordination, and ADA-aware placement. We handle the full scope.

Apartment & Townhome Parking

Multi-family installs require thoughtful charger placement — designated stalls, shared chargers, or load-managed banks — coordinated with HOAs and property managers.

Do I need an electrician to install an EV charger?

Yes. A licensed electrician is required for safe, code-compliant EV charger installation. EV chargers run on a high-amperage 240-volt dedicated circuit, often require a panel evaluation or upgrade, and must meet National Electrical Code (NEC) and local Indiana permitting requirements. What is a Level 2 EV charger?

A Level 2 EV charger is a 240-volt charging station that delivers roughly 3 to 10 times faster charging than a standard 120-volt outlet — typically adding 20–40 miles of range per hour. Level 2 chargers require a dedicated 240V circuit installed by a licensed electrician and are the standard choice for home and commercial EV charging.

Can my electrical panel handle an EV charger?

It depends on the panel's available capacity and your home's existing load. Branch Electric performs a load evaluation before every install. If the panel is full or undersized, we recommend a panel upgrade, a subpanel, or load-management hardware to safely support the EV charger.

Do I need a dedicated circuit for an EV charger?

Yes. EV chargers require their own dedicated 240-volt circuit, properly sized to the charger's amperage (typically 30A to 60A). Sharing a circuit is not code-compliant and can cause overheating, breaker trips, and fire risk. Branch Electric installs every EV charger on a dedicated, properly sized circuit.

Can EV chargers be installed outdoors?

Yes. Most modern Level 2 EV chargers are rated for outdoor installation (NEMA 4 or equivalent) and can be mounted on exterior walls, posts, pedestals, or carports. Branch Electric installs outdoor EV chargers with weather-rated enclosures, conduit, and breakers — fully sealed and code-compliant for Indiana weather.

Do permits matter for EV charger installation?

Yes. Most Central Indiana jurisdictions require a permit and inspection for EV charger installation. Permits protect the property owner, satisfy insurance requirements, and confirm the work meets the National Electrical Code. Branch Electric pulls permits and coordinates inspections as part of every install where required.

How long does EV charger installation usually take?

Most straightforward home EV charger installations take 3–6 hours. Installations that involve a panel upgrade, long conduit runs, or outdoor trenching can take a full day or longer. Branch Electric provides a clear timeline with every estimate so you know exactly what to expect.
